What You’ll See and Do
Gulludere Vadisi (Rose Valley)
We love starting in the Rose Valley, especially late in the day when the sunlight bathes the rocks in a beautiful rosy glow. The valley is famous for its towering cone-shaped rocks and historic cave churches like the Cross Church and Columned Church. The roughly 25-minute stop allows for a quick but scenic walk, perfect for stretching your legs and snapping photos. The admission is free, making it a cost-effective way to experience this stunning natural feature.
This is a favorite among those who enjoy light hiking or photography. The landscape is simply breathtaking, especially during the golden hour, and it’s a great spot to learn about local geology and history from your guide.
Pigeon Valley
Next, you’ll enjoy a panoramic viewpoint at Pigeon Valley, named after the many pigeon houses carved into the cliffs. These structures were historically used by locals to feed the birds, which played an important role in the region’s agriculture and communications. The 20-minute stop is ideal for appreciating the vastness of the landscape and understanding some local practices, as your guide will share more details.
This stop is particularly appreciated for the spectacular views of the valley stretching out before you. It’s a relaxed moment that balances the more active parts of the day.
Paabalar Museum and Fairy Chimneys
The Paabalar Museum offers a closer look at the fascinating fairy chimneys — tall, mushroom-shaped rock formations. Some are double-headed or triple, showcasing nature’s whimsical architecture. The 45-minute visit allows for photo opportunities and learning about how these shapes form over time.
Although entrance fees are not included, this site is a visual treat. Travelers on this tour often comment on the variety of shapes, which make for excellent photos. If you’re a fan of geology or just love quirky landscapes, this stop is well worth it.
Underground Cities: Ozkonak
Cappadocia’s underground cities are legendary, and this tour includes a visit to Ozkonak Underground City. Carved into the soft volcanic rock, these subterranean complexes were used as refuges during invasions. Your guide will explain how people lived in these labyrinths, with tunnels, rooms, and even ventilation shafts.
The 1-hour visit offers a fascinating glimpse into ancient ingenuity. Keep in mind, some narrow passages might require a bit of crawling or bending, so moderate physical fitness helps. This site is a highlight for history buffs but can be a bit intense for those wary of confined spaces.
Goreme Open-Air Museum
The Goreme Open-Air Museum is arguably the most iconic stop. Over two hours, you’ll explore rock-cut churches and monasteries filled with remarkable frescoes dating from the early Christian era. Your guide will share insights into religious life, art, and architecture of the time.
This site is a must-see, and most visitors find it fascinating and educational. Entrance fees are not included, so budget accordingly. The site can get crowded, so arriving early or late in the day might enhance your experience.
Uçhisar Castle
The tour concludes at Uçhisar Castle, a volcanic rock formation riddled with tunnels and rooms. Climb to the top for panoramic views that are especially striking at sunset. The 20-minute stop is free and offers a beautiful perspective of the surrounding valleys and fairy chimneys.
This is a perfect spot to reflect on your day and enjoy some of the best vistas of Cappadocia. Plus, the castle’s natural fortress-like appearance makes it a memorable finale.
